AutoCheck + Salvage - £20k Guarantee

Powered by Experian Automotive

Protect your interests when buying or selling vehicles with AutoCheck, the comprehensive vehicle history check from Experian.

 

Includes a 12 month, £20,000 Experian Data Guarantee (terms and conditions www.experian.co.uk/data-guarantee)


Key Features

£20,000 Data Guarantee

Includes a 12 month, £20,000 Experian-backed indemnity (terms and conditions apply)

Outstanding Finance

Identify whether there is outstanding finance on a vehicle

Condition Data

MIAFTR data identifies vehicles previously written-off by an insurer

Stolen Status

Police National Computer (PNC) data identifies whether a vehicle is currently marked as stolen

Keeper & Plate Change History

Identify previous keeper and plate changes

High Risk Markers

Identifies where a security marker has been added to a vehicle by an interested party (B2B only)

Pricing

PAYG
£4.50
Per Use

Sample Response

Documentation

Introduction

This endpoint identifies whether a vehicle has outstanding finance, is recorded as stolen or has previously been written off, along with a 12 month, £20,000 Experian Data Guarantee (see: www.experian.co.uk/data-guarantee). Please read our 'Understanding status codes' Knowledge Base article on handling VOID VRM (206) responses before implementing this endpoint.

Header

When making calls to our API, include the following header:

x-api-key:your-api-key-here

Example Request

https://api.oneautoapi.com/experian/autocheck-20k-guarantee?vehicle_registration_mark=AB21ABC&vehicle_identification_number=ABCDE123456F78910

Example Sandbox Request

https://sandbox.oneautoapi.com/experian/autocheck-20k-guarantee?vehicle_registration_mark=AB21ABC&vehicle_identification_number=ABCDE123456F78910

Request Parameters

vehicle_registration_mark
mandatory, string, e.g. AB21ABC
Vehicle registration number
vehicle_identification_number
optional, string, e.g. ABCDE123456F78910
Vehicle identification number

Sample Response

{
  "success": true,
  "result": {
    "date_last_updated": "2020-01-01",
    "vehicle_registration_mark": "AB21ABC",
    "does_vehicle_registration_mark_match": false,
    "does_vehicle_identification_number_match": true,
    "dvla_manufacturer_desc": "NISSAN",
    "dvla_model_desc": "QASHQAI ACENTA PREMIUM DCI",
    "dvla_fuel_desc": "DIESEL",
    "dvla_body_desc": "5 DOOR HATCHBACK",
    "dvla_doorplan_code": 14,
    "dvla_transmission_code": "M",
    "dvla_transmission_desc": "MANUAL 6 GEARS",
    "number_gears": 6,
    "mvris_code": "A1ABC",
    "mvris_manufacturer_code": "A1",
    "mvris_model_code": "ABC",
    "dvla_dtp_manufacturer_code": "AB",
    "dvla_dtp_model_code": "587",
    "number_seats": 5,
    "dvla_wheelplan": "2 AXLE RIGID BODY",
    "registration_date": "2020-01-01",
    "manufactured_year": 2020,
    "vehicle_identification_number": "ABCDE123456F78910",
    "first_registration_date": "2020-01-01",
    "used_before_first_registration": true,
    "co2_gkm": 123,
    "engine_capacity_cc": 1234,
    "engine_number": "A12345678",
    "is_scrapped": true,
    "scrapped_date": "2020-01-01",
    "certificate_of_destruction_issued": true,
    "is_exported": true,
    "was_exported": false,
    "exported_date": "2020-01-01",
    "is_imported": true,
    "imported_date": "2020-01-01",
    "is_non_eu_import": true,
    "prior_gb_vrm": "AB21ABC",
    "prior_ni_vrm": "ABC1234",
    "colour": "RED",
    "original_colour": "BLUE",
    "number_previous_colours": 1,
    "maximum_permissable_mass_kg": 1234,
    "power_weight_ratio_kw_kg": 0.1234,
    "min_kerbweight_kg": 1234,
    "gross_vehicleweight_kg": 1234,
    "max_netpower_kw": 12,
    "max_braked_towing_weight_kg": 1234,
    "max_unbraked_towing_weight_kg": 123,
    "stationary_soundlevel_db": 12,
    "stationary_soundlevel_rpm": 1234,
    "driveby_soundlevel_db": 12,
    "v5c_data_qty": 1,
    "v5c_data_items": [
      {
        "date_v5c_issued": "2020-01-01"
      }
    ],
    "vehicle_identity_check_qty": 1,
    "vehicle_identity_check_items": [
      {
        "date_of_vehicle_identity_check": "2020-01-01",
        "result_of_vehicle_identity_check": "Pass"
      }
    ],
    "keeper_changes_qty": 1,
    "keeper_data_items": [
      {
        "date_last_updated": "2020-01-01",
        "number_previous_keepers": 1,
        "date_of_last_keeper_change": "2020-01-01"
      }
    ],
    "colour_changes_qty": 1,
    "colour_data_items": [
      {
        "date_last_updated": "2020-01-01",
        "number_previous_colours": 1,
        "date_of_last_colour_change": "2020-01-01",
        "last_colour": "BLUE"
      }
    ],
    "finance_data_qty": 1,
    "finance_data_items": [
      {
        "date_last_updated": "2020-01-01",
        "finance_start_date": "2020-01-01",
        "finance_term_months": 12,
        "finance_type": "HIRE PURCHASE",
        "finance_company": "A FINANCE CO",
        "finance_company_contact_number": "01234 567891",
        "finance_agreement_number": "S1234567",
        "financed_vehicle_desc": "NISSAN QASHQAI ACENTA"
      }
    ],
    "cherished_data_qty": 1,
    "cherished_data_items": [
      {
        "cherished_plate_transfer_date": "2020-01-01",
        "previous_vehicle_registration_mark": "AB21ABC",
        "date_of_receipt": "2020-01-01",
        "transfer_type": "Marker",
        "current_vehicle_registration_mark": "AB21ABC"
      }
    ],
    "condition_data_qty": 1,
    "condition_data_items": [
      {
        "date_last_updated": "2020-01-01",
        "date_of_loss": "2020-01-01",
        "vehicle_status": "RECOVERED - NON-STRUCTURE DAMAGE",
        "theft_indictor_literal": "RECOVERED",
        "date_of_miaftr_entry": "2020-01-01",
        "insurer_name": "EXAMPLE INSURANCE CO",
        "insurer_contact_number": "01234 567891",
        "insurer_claim_number": "EXAMPLE",
        "loss_type": "T",
        "recovered_category_desc": "Non-structure damage",
        "recovered_category": "N",
        "insurer_make": "NISS",
        "insurer_model": "QAS",
        "insurer_code": "1234",
        "insurer_branch": 12345,
        "theft_indicator": "R",
        "date_removed": "2020-01-01",
        "cause_of_damage": "Accident",
        "damage_location_items": [
          {
            "damage_location_desc": "FrontOffside"
          }
        ]
      }
    ],
    "stolen_vehicle_data_qty": 1,
    "stolen_vehicle_data_items": [
      {
        "date_last_updated": "2020-01-01",
        "date_reported": "2020-01-01",
        "is_stolen": false,
        "police_force": "COUNTY POLICE FORCE",
        "police_force_contact_number": "01234 567891"
      }
    ],
    "high_risk_data_qty": 1,
    "high_risk_data_items": [
      {
        "date_last_updated": "2020-01-01",
        "date_of_interest": "2020-01-01",
        "registration_period": 12,
        "high_risk_type": "AT RISK",
        "extra_information": "Additional information relating to high risk",
        "company_name": "A FINANCE CO",
        "company_contact_number": "01234 567891",
        "company_contact_reference": "Reference"
      }
    ],
    "previous_search_qty": 1,
    "previous_search_items": [
      {
        "date_of_search": "2021-08-14",
        "time_of_search": "10:56:18",
        "business_type_searching": "MOTOR TRADE & OTHER"
      }
    ],
    "salvage_check_result": {
      "salvage_auction_record_found": true,
      "salvage_auction_records": [
        {
          "salvage_auction_record_id": 1234567,
          "salvage_auction_reference": 1234567,
          "salvage_auction_lot_desc": "CAT B - Breaker",
          "salvage_auction_lot_date": "2020-01-01",
          "mileage": 12345,
          "primary_damage_desc": "Rear End",
          "secondary_damage_desc": "Side",
          "salvage_auction_location": "York",
          "external_image_urls": [
            "http://exampleauctionhouse/example/12345"
          ]
        }
      ]
    },
    "indemnity_months": 12,
    "indemnity_gbp": 10000
  },
  "error": "If there is an error the message would go here"
}

Response Parameters

success
e.g. true
Whether the api call was successful
date_last_updated
e.g. 2020-01-01
Date record was last updated
vehicle_registration_mark
e.g. AB21ABC
Vehicle registration number (VRM).
does_vehicle_registration_mark_match
e.g. false
Does the VRM returned in the response match the input VRM
does_vehicle_identification_number_match
e.g. true
Does the supplied vehicle_registration_mark and vehicle_identifcation input parameters match.
dvla_manufacturer_desc
e.g. NISSAN
DVLA manufacturer description.
dvla_model_desc
e.g. QASHQAI ACENTA PREMIUM DCI
DVLA model description.
dvla_fuel_desc
e.g. DIESEL
DVLA fuel description.
dvla_body_desc
e.g. 5 DOOR HATCHBACK
DVLA body description.
dvla_doorplan_code
e.g. 14
DVLA door plan code.
dvla_transmission_code
e.g. M
DVLA transmission code.
dvla_transmission_desc
e.g. MANUAL 6 GEARS
DVLA transmission description.
number_gears
e.g. 6
Number of gears.
mvris_code
e.g. A1ABC
MVRIS Code
mvris_manufacturer_code
e.g. A1
MVRIS manufacturer code.
mvris_model_code
e.g. ABC
MVRIS model code.
dvla_dtp_manufacturer_code
e.g. AB
DVLA DTP manufacturer code.
dvla_dtp_model_code
e.g. 587
DVLA DTP model code
number_seats
e.g. 5
Number of seats.
dvla_wheelplan
e.g. 2 AXLE RIGID BODY
DVLA wheelplan code.
registration_date
e.g. 2020-01-01
Date the vehicle was first registered in the UK.
manufactured_year
e.g. 2020
Year of manufacture.
vehicle_identification_number
e.g. ABCDE123456F78910
Vehicle identification number (VIN).
first_registration_date
e.g. 2020-01-01
Date of first registration.
used_before_first_registration
e.g. true
Vehicle was used before DVLA/DLNI first registration.
co2_gkm
e.g. 123
CO2 in g/km
engine_capacity_cc
e.g. 1234
Cubic capacity of the engine.
engine_number
e.g. A12345678
Vehicle engine number.
is_scrapped
e.g. true
Has the vehicle been scrapped.
scrapped_date
e.g. 2020-01-01
Date the vehicle was scrapped.
certificate_of_destruction_issued
e.g. true
Has a certificate of destruction been issued.
is_exported
e.g. true
Vehicle is exported.
was_exported
e.g. false
Vehicle was exported.
exported_date
e.g. 2020-01-01
Date vehicle was exported.
is_imported
e.g. true
Vehicle is imported.
imported_date
e.g. 2020-01-01
Date vehicle was imported
is_non_eu_import
e.g. true
Vehicle is non-eu import.
prior_gb_vrm
e.g. AB21ABC
Previous GB vehicle registration mark
prior_ni_vrm
e.g. ABC1234
Previous NI vehicle registration mark.
colour
e.g. RED
Exterior colour of vehicle.
original_colour
e.g. BLUE
Vehicle's original colour.
number_previous_colours
e.g. 1
The number of previous colours
maximum_permissable_mass_kg
e.g. 1234
Maximum permissable mass in kilograms.
power_weight_ratio_kw_kg
e.g. 0.1234
Power to weight ratio kilowatts per kilograms.
min_kerbweight_kg
e.g. 1234
Weight of the vehicle, including a full tank of fuel and all standard equipment in kilograms.
gross_vehicleweight_kg
e.g. 1234
Total weight of the vehicle including the Kerb Weight and Payload Weight in kilograms.
max_netpower_kw
e.g. 12
Maximum net power in kilowatts.
max_braked_towing_weight_kg
e.g. 1234
Maximum braked towing weight in kilograms,
max_unbraked_towing_weight_kg
e.g. 123
Maximum unbraked towing weight in kilograms.
stationary_soundlevel_db
e.g. 12
Sound level in decibels whilst vehicle is stationary.
stationary_soundlevel_rpm
e.g. 1234
Sound level in decibels for Engine speed levels.
driveby_soundlevel_db
e.g. 12
Sound level in decibels for the drive by levels.
v5c_data_qty
e.g. 1
Number of V5C Certificates.
date_v5c_issued
e.g. 2020-01-01
Date the v5 was issued.
vehicle_identity_check_qty
e.g. 1
Number of vehicle identity checks.
date_of_vehicle_identity_check
e.g. 2020-01-01
Date of (previous) vehicle identity check(s)
result_of_vehicle_identity_check
e.g. Pass
Result of vehicle identity check
keeper_changes_qty
e.g. 1
Number of keeper changes.
date_last_updated
e.g. 2020-01-01
Date record was last updated
number_previous_keepers
e.g. 1
Number of previous keepers.
date_of_last_keeper_change
e.g. 2020-01-01
Date of last keeper change.
colour_changes_qty
e.g. 1
Colour change quantity.
date_last_updated
e.g. 2020-01-01
Date record was last updated
number_previous_colours
e.g. 1
The number of previous colours
date_of_last_colour_change
e.g. 2020-01-01
Date of last colour change.
last_colour
e.g. BLUE
Vehicle's last colour
finance_data_qty
e.g. 1
The finance data quantity.
date_last_updated
e.g. 2020-01-01
Date record was last updated
finance_start_date
e.g. 2020-01-01
The date finance agreement starts.
finance_term_months
e.g. 12
The term of finance agreement in months.
finance_type
e.g. HIRE PURCHASE
The finance type.
finance_company
e.g. A FINANCE CO
The finance company.
finance_company_contact_number
e.g. 01234 567891
The finance company contact number.
finance_agreement_number
e.g. S1234567
The finance agreement number.
financed_vehicle_desc
e.g. NISSAN QASHQAI ACENTA
The financed vehicle.
cherished_data_qty
e.g. 1
The cherished data quantity.
cherished_plate_transfer_date
e.g. 2020-01-01
Plate transfer date.
previous_vehicle_registration_mark
e.g. AB21ABC
Previous vehicle registration mark.
date_of_receipt
e.g. 2020-01-01
Recorded date of transfer at DVLA.
transfer_type
e.g. Marker
Plate transfer type.
current_vehicle_registration_mark
e.g. AB21ABC
Current vehicle registration mark.
condition_data_qty
e.g. 1
The condition data quantity.
date_last_updated
e.g. 2020-01-01
Date record was last updated
date_of_loss
e.g. 2020-01-01
Date of loss.
vehicle_status
e.g. RECOVERED - NON-STRUCTURE DAMAGE
Vehicle's stolen status.
theft_indictor_literal
e.g. RECOVERED
Theft indicator.
date_of_miaftr_entry
e.g. 2020-01-01
MIAFTR entry date.
insurer_name
e.g. EXAMPLE INSURANCE CO
Insurer's name.
insurer_contact_number
e.g. 01234 567891
Insurer's contact number.
insurer_claim_number
e.g. EXAMPLE
Insurer's claim number.
loss_type
e.g. T
The flag to indicate type of loss for old insurance motor claims.
recovered_category_desc
e.g. Non-structure damage
The recovered category description.
recovered_category
e.g. N
Recovered category
insurer_make
e.g. NISS
Insurer's manufacturer description.
insurer_model
e.g. QAS
Insurer's model description.
insurer_code
e.g. 1234
Insurer's code.
insurer_branch
e.g. 12345
Insurer's branch number.
theft_indicator
e.g. R
Theft indicator.
date_removed
e.g. 2020-01-01
Date the condition was removed.
cause_of_damage
e.g. Accident
Cause of damage.
damage_location_desc
e.g. FrontOffside
The location of the damage
stolen_vehicle_data_qty
e.g. 1
The stolen vehicle data quantity.
date_last_updated
e.g. 2020-01-01
Date record was last updated
date_reported
e.g. 2020-01-01
Date vehicle was reported as stolen.
is_stolen
e.g. false
Is the vehicle stolen
police_force
e.g. COUNTY POLICE FORCE
Investigating police force.
police_force_contact_number
e.g. 01234 567891
Investigating police force contact number.
high_risk_data_qty
e.g. 1
The high risk data quantity.
date_last_updated
e.g. 2020-01-01
Date record was last updated
date_of_interest
e.g. 2020-01-01
The date vehicle was marked as high risk.
registration_period
e.g. 12
The registration period in months.
high_risk_type
e.g. AT RISK
The high risk type.
extra_information
e.g. Additional information relating to high risk
The additional information relating to high risk.
company_name
e.g. A FINANCE CO
The company holding an interest in the vehicle.
company_contact_number
e.g. 01234 567891
The company contact number.
company_contact_reference
e.g. Reference
The company contact reference.
previous_search_qty
e.g. 1
The previous search quantity.
date_of_search
e.g. 2021-08-14
Date of the last search.
time_of_search
e.g. 10:56:18
Time of search (hh:mm:ss)
business_type_searching
e.g. MOTOR TRADE & OTHER
Type of business type conducting the check.
salvage_auction_record_found
e.g. true
Salvage record has been found
salvage_auction_record_id
e.g. 1234567
Salvage record id
salvage_auction_reference
e.g. 1234567
The salvage auction lot ID or reference number
salvage_auction_lot_desc
e.g. CAT B - Breaker
Salvage auction lot description
salvage_auction_lot_date
e.g. 2020-01-01
The salvage auction date
mileage
e.g. 12345
The current mileage of the vehicle in full
primary_damage_desc
e.g. Rear End
The primary damage description
secondary_damage_desc
e.g. Side
The secondary damage description
salvage_auction_location
e.g. York
Salvage auction's location
indemnity_months
e.g. 12
Indemnity period in months for any data guarantee purchased as part of the check,
indemnity_gbp
e.g. 10000
Indemnity amount in GBP for any data guarantee purchased as part of the check.
error
e.g. If there is an error the message would go here
Details of what went wrong with the api call

Status Codes

200
success, chargeable
Request has been successfully received and a response has been sent.
202
accepted, non-chargeable
Request has been received and accepted for processing, but the action has not yet been completed.
204
no content, non-chargeable
Request has been successfully received but there is no content to return e.g. if an invalid VRM has been sent.
206
partial content, non-chargeable
Request has been successfully received but limited content is returned e.g. if an invalid VRM has been sent.
400
bad request, non-chargeable
Request was not received e.g. if any required parameters are missing.
403
forbidden, non-chargeable
Request was rejected e.g. if the API key is invalid or the service is not enabled.
429
too many requests, non-chargeable
API key rate limit/quota has been exceeded.
500
internal server error, non-chargeable
We are unable to process the request e.g. if the API is under extremely heavy load.
503
service unavailable, non-chargeable
Service is temporarily unavailable. Contact help@oneautoapi.com

Also Available From Experian

One Auto API Limited
Terms Privacy Policy